Green Plains (NASDAQ:GPRE) Stock Price Up 8.1%

Green Plains Inc. (NASDAQ:GPREGet Free Report)’s share price traded up 8.1% during trading on Wednesday . The company traded as high as $14.19 and last traded at $14.11. 163,376 shares were traded during trading, a decline of 85% from the average session volume of 1,119,001 shares. The stock had previously closed at $13.05.

Green Plains Price Performance

The firm’s 50 day moving average is $15.21 and its 200 day moving average is $18.33. The firm has a market cap of $896.91 million, a P/E ratio of -11.28 and a beta of 1.58.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.55, a current ratio of 1.68 and a quick ratio of 1.11.

Green Plains (NASDAQ:GPREG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 6th. The specialty chemicals company reported ($0.38)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.03) by ($0.35). Green Plains had a negative net margin of 1.64% and a negative return on equity of 4.94%. The business had revenue of $618.83 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$646.70 million. During the same period last year, the company posted ($0.89) earnings per share. The business’s revenue was down 27.8%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, analysts anticipate that Green Plains Inc. will post -0.74 earnings per share for the current year.

Green Plains Company Profile

Green Plains Inc produces low-carbon fuels in the United States and internationally. It operates through three segments: Ethanol Production, Agribusiness and Energy Services, and Partnership. The Ethanol Production segment produces ethanol, distillers grains, and ultra-high protein and renewable corn oil.
